Control Module and Hydraulic Unit

Fig 1: Control Module And Hydraulic Unit
GWWA45-10196Courtesy of AUDI OF AMERICA, LLC
  1. Bracket
  2. Nut
    • 20 Nm
  3. Rubber Bushing
  4. Mounting Bracket
  5. ABS Hydraulic Unit -N55-
  6. ABS Control Module -J104-
  7. Brake Line
    • 14 Nm
    • From brake master cylinder to the hydraulic unit
    • License plate: 5.25 mm diameter and union bolt with M12x1 thread
  8. Brake Line
    • 14 Nm
    • From brake master cylinder to the hydraulic unit
    • License plate: 6 mm diameter and union bolt with M12x1 thread
  9. Torx® Bolt
    • Replace after removing
    • Tighten the new Torx® bolts in two steps, switching back and forth.
    • 1. Step: preliminary tightening specification: 1 Nm to 1.5 Nm (to position the seal)
    • 2. Step: final tightening specification: 2.5 Nm
  10. Heat Shield
    • There are different versions. Refer to the Electronic Parts Information (ETKA) for the allocation.
    • Threaded version. Refer to Fig 2.
  11. Torx® Bolt
    • 8 Nm

Heat Shield - Threaded Version

Fig 2: Heat Shield - Threaded Version
GWWA45-10350Courtesy of AUDI OF AMERICA, LLC

-- Tighten the nut -1- to 8 Nm.

-- Press on the bracket for the lock washer -3- all the way.

ABS Control Module -J104-

Fig 3: Identifying Pressure Sensor Contact, Pressure Sensor, Seal, Valve Bodies And Pump Motor Contact
GWWA45-10122Courtesy of AUDI OF AMERICA, LLC
  1. Pressure Sensor Contact
    • Do not touch the contacts
    • The illustration depends on the model
  2. Pressure Sensor
    • Must not be changed or damaged
    • Cannot be replaced
    • The illustration depends on the model
  3. Seal
    • Must not be pulled out or raised up
    • Cannot be replaced
  4. Valve Body
    • Must not be damaged or bent
    • Do not use any tools
  5. Pump Motor Contact
    • Must not be damaged or bent
